![]() “Cherokee Nation Entertainment has a rich history of operating award-winning hospitality destinations in Oklahoma, and we are proud to continue our growth in gaming and bring the level of excellence we are known for to the Tunica area,” said Mark Fulton, president of Cherokee Nation Entertainment (CNE). (NYSE: VICI), the Gold Strike property owner. CNE Gaming Holdings, LLC, will enter into a long-term lease agreement with VICI Properties Inc. The purchase price represents an EBITDA multiple of approximately six times, based on 2021 Adjusted Property EDITBAR of $115 million. – Cherokee Nation Entertainment Gaming Holdings, LLC, a subsidiary of Cherokee Nation Businesses, today announced it has reached an agreement with MGM Resorts International (NYSE: MGM) to purchase the operations of Gold Strike Tunica for $450 million in cash, subject to customary adjustments.
